Concern over U.S. travel visas prompts Ig Nobels to move its awards to Europe
- The Ig Nobel Awards are moving from the United States to Europe due to travel visa concerns.
- Organizers cite visa-related administrative hurdles as the primary reason for the relocation.
- The change highlights broader challenges for international participation in U.S.-based events.
- The awards are expected to retain their scientific humor and multi-referenced topics in Europe.
